Overview Summary
The Sherwood SHR0241861R 11.20mm HSS Bell Type Centre Drill is engineered for precise centering and pilot hole preparation in demanding metalworking applications. Made from premium High Speed Steel (HSS), it provides excellent wear resistance, heat tolerance, and long service life.
Designed to create accurate starting points for larger drills, this bell type centre drill helps reduce drill wander and improves hole alignment. Ideal for machinists, engineers, and professional workshop users who require consistent precision and durability.
